如何知道我的MongoDB数据库开销何时达到极限?
题
我在服务器上安装了MongoDB数据库。我的服务器处于32位,我无法尽快更改。
当您在32位体系结构中使用MongoDB时,您将有2.5GO的数据限制,如在 这篇MongoDB博客文章.
问题是我有几个数据库。那么,我怎么知道我是否接近这个限制呢?
解决方案
当您达到极限时,Mongo将开始抛出断言。如果您查看日志,它将有很多错误消息(有益)告诉您切换到64位计算机。
使用mongo壳,您可以说:
> use admin
> db.runCommand({listDatabases : 1})
要了解您的距离有多近。大小为字节。
不隶属于 StackOverflow